Vogue Mexico Adapts the Met Gala Formula for Day of the Dead

The publication on Thursday hosted its third gala celebrating the Mexican holiday. “We want this event to be shared globally,” its top editor said.

MEXICO CITY — The formula was familiar: invitations from Vogue; a carpet filled with celebrities, fashion designers and models dressed to the nines; even a theme: Day of the Dead.

Last Thursday night, these elements came together not on the steps of the Metropolitan Museum of Art in New York, but at a museum in Mexico’s capital city, where Vogue Mexico held its third gala celebrating Día de Muertos.
